Post
#1
|
|
|
Grupa: Zarejestrowani Postów: 1 885 Pomógł: 231 Dołączył: 20.03.2005 Skąd: Będzin Ostrzeżenie: (0%)
|
Mam zapytanie następujące:
Zapytanie jest poprawne, znaczy wyświetla to co oczekuje, tak jak oczekuję. Na tą chwilę. Jednak nie podoba mi się forma przedstawienia dołączeń do atrybutów, czyli wiele LEFT JOINów do tej samej tabeli. Chciałbym się dowiedzieć czy jest jakieś inne rozwiązanie, które skróciloby takie zapytanie, bo jeżeli w przyszłości dotarłyby kolejne atrybuty, to należałoby rozszerzyć zapytanie o kolejnego LEFTa, a chciałbym tego uniknąć. |
|
|
|
![]() |
Post
#2
|
|
|
Grupa: Zarejestrowani Postów: 1 885 Pomógł: 231 Dołączył: 20.03.2005 Skąd: Będzin Ostrzeżenie: (0%)
|
Czyli albo tak jak jest teraz, albo z dodatkową usługą obsługi zapytań. Mówi się trudno.
Dzięki. |
|
|
|
Tomplus Skrócenie zapytania SQL 26.09.2017, 08:40:26
trueblue A tak?
[SQL] pobierz, plaintext LEFT JOIN `atrybut... 26.09.2017, 08:45:20
Tomplus Nie.
To daje 3 rekordy na każdy towar.
Zamiast:
... 26.09.2017, 10:22:27
Crozin Czyli standardowe pocdejście przy pracy z RDBMS-am... 26.09.2017, 11:05:47
Pyton_000 Najwygodniej to pobrać produkt, potem pobrać wszys... 26.09.2017, 11:25:22
trueblue Ok, rozumiem. Coś w rodzaju tabeli przestawnej.
N... 26.09.2017, 11:51:24 ![]() ![]() |
|
Aktualny czas: 28.12.2025 - 19:03 |